    Just remove the output buffering (ob_start() and the others).

    Use just this:

    ftp_get($conn_id, "php://output", $file, FTP_BINARY);
    

    Though if you want to add Content-Length header, you have to query file size first using ftp_size:

    $conn_id = ftp_connect("ftp.example.com");
    ftp_login($conn_id, "username", "password");
    ftp_pasv($conn_id, true);
    
    $file_path = "remote/path/file.zip";
    $size = ftp_size($conn_id, $file_path);
    
    header("Content-Type: application/octet-stream");
    header("Content-Disposition: attachment; filename=" . basename($file_path));
    header("Content-Length: $size"); 
    
    ftp_get($conn_id, "php://output", $file_path, FTP_BINARY);
    

    (add error handling)
